The Washington Demons bowling squad finished 2nd in Thursday’s triangular in Mt. Pleasant, with Keokuk coming out on top and the hosts finishing in third.

Washington finished with a score of 2809, 120 away from the 2929 put up by Keokuk. Mt. Pleasant scored 2552. Heading into Bakers, Keokuk led with 2008, with Washington in second at 1860 and Mt. Pleasant not far behind at 1791.

Mitchell Zieglowsky led Washington with a total of 431 pins across two games. Kaeden Zear turned in a score of 422. Kellton Burke had 382, Cooper Zahs bowled a 321, Mason Pierce bowled a 304, and Mason Catenaccio bowled a 303.

The Demons will face off with Keokuk again next Tuesday for another triangular, joined this time by Central Lee.
